Benzema to Benfica: Mourinho Addresses Transfer Rumors Head-On

Karim Benzema to Benfica transfer rumors have intensified over recent weeks, with speculation suggesting a potential reunion between the prolific French striker and Jose Mourinho, now at the helm of the Portuguese giants. However, Mourinho has firmly denied the possibility, clarifying Benzema’s current status and future plans.

Karim Benzema to Benfica: Mourinho Dispels the Speculation

Karim Benzema to Benfica seemed like a storyline destined to capture headlines across Europe, especially following reports that the former Real Madrid forward was considering an exit from Saudi club Al-Ittihad. With Mourinho’s arrival at Benfica, social media buzzed about a blockbuster January reunion. Yet, Mourinho addressed these rumors in a press conference, providing direct insight into the situation.

According to Mourinho, “Karim Benzema is not looking for a move right now. He’s very happy at Al-Ittihad, both in terms of lifestyle and financial comfort.” The 37-year-old has enjoyed a fruitful career, collecting trophies with Real Madrid before securing a lucrative move to the Saudi Pro League. Despite a stellar reputation and proven goal-scoring track record, the coach emphasized that Benzema’s focus remains on his current club.

Mourinho’s Perspective on Benzema’s Saudi Adventure

Mourinho elaborated on why Karim Benzema to Benfica remains unlikely, highlighting the striker’s satisfaction in Saudi Arabia. “Karim is thriving there, both on and off the pitch. He is not seeking a change,” Mourinho stated, shutting down hopes of a winter transfer. Financially, Benzema’s contract at Al-Ittihad offers terms rarely matched in European football, adding another layer of complexity to any potential move.
